Breach and Attack Simulation (BAS) software helps organizations continuously test how well their security controls detect, block, and respond to realistic attack scenarios. It automates safe simulations of common tactics, techniques, and procedures so teams can validate defenses without waiting for an actual incident. For buyers comparing the best breach and attack simulation software, the category is useful for understanding whether security tools are working as intended across endpoints, networks, cloud environments, and email systems.

Security operations teams, SOC analysts, incident response groups, and CISOs typically use BAS tools to measure exposure, prioritize remediation, and track security posture over time. Common use cases include control validation, attack path testing, purple team exercises, and readiness checks for ransomware, phishing, and lateral movement scenarios. These top breach and attack simulation tools often include scenario libraries, automated testing, risk scoring, reporting dashboards, and integrations with SIEM, EDR, and vulnerability management platforms.

The practical value of BAS software is in giving organizations a repeatable way to identify gaps before attackers do and to verify that security investments are delivering expected results. It can also support compliance efforts by documenting testing activity and helping teams focus remediation on the most important weaknesses. For many businesses, the category provides a clearer view of defensive effectiveness and a more efficient way to coordinate security improvements.
